MEMORANDUM OPINION


Appellant has filed a motion to dismiss this appeal. In its motion, Appellant states that the parties have reached a final resolution of all claims in the underlying suit. A copy of the motion has been sent to all counsel of record. Because Appellant has met the requirements of Texas Rule of Appellate Procedure 42.1(a)(1), the motion is granted, and the appeal is dismissed. The costs of this appeal are assessed against the party incurring them.
